About Ergin Tarı

Ergin Tarı is a scholar working on Geophysics, Civil and Structural Engineering, Aerospace Engineering, Mechanical Engineering and Statistical and Nonlinear Physics, having authored 16 papers that have together received 348 indexed citations. Recurring topics across this work include earthquake and tectonic studies (9 papers), Earthquake Detection and Analysis (6 papers), High-pressure geophysics and materials (6 papers), Geological and Geochemical Analysis (3 papers), 3D Surveying and Cultural Heritage (2 papers), Soil Mechanics and Vehicle Dynamics (2 papers), Railway Engineering and Dynamics (2 papers) and GNSS positioning and interference (2 papers). The work is most often cited by research in Geophysics (198 citations), General Engineering (8 citations), Computer Graphics and Computer-Aided Design (13 citations), Oceanography (39 citations) and Civil and Structural Engineering (51 citations). Ergin Tarı has collaborated with scholars based in Türkiye, United States and France. Frequent co-authors include Semih Ergintav, Robert Reilinger, Ziyadin Çakır, Hakan Yavaşoğlu, S. McClusky, Okan Tüysüz, Onur Lenk, E. H. Hearn, Haluk Özener and T. A. Herring. Their work appears in journals such as Earth Planets and Space, Journal of Earthquake Engineering, Journal of Geodynamics, Bulletin de la Société Géologique de France and Remote Sensing.
